This category contains information about parallel programming languages, including extensions to existing sequential languages as well as completely new languages. Message-passing libraries that allow writing parallel programs in a normally sequential language are listed in Computers/Parallel_Computing/Programming.

  • PARSEC - PARallel Simulation Environment for Complex systems. C-based simulation language for sequential and parallel execution of discrete-event simulation models. Online technical support, manuals, source code. Replaced Maisie language.
  • Parallaxis-III - Structured language for data-parallel programming (SIMD systems), based on sequential Modula-2, extended. Source code, binaries, sample code, documents.
  • JavaParty - A minimal extension to Java easing distributed parallel programming of cluster computers. A source code transformation automatically generates a distributed pure Java program based on RMI or KaRMI.
  • Orca - Language for parallel programming on distributed systems, based on the shared data-object model, a portable form of object-based distributed shared memory. Papers and manual.
  • Maisie - C-based simulation language that can be used for sequential and parallel execution of discrete-event simulation models. Papers, source code, sample models. Replaced by PARSEC language.
  • Z++ - An extension of C++ to platform-free distributed computing. It enhances C++ with invariants, threading, database, GUI and conponent-oriented design. Z++ virtual processor supports the entire language on many platforms.
  • Jade - Jade is a parallel extension to C that allows transparent access to shared memory. Papers, manual, and source code.
  • mpC - Parallel extension to C designed for applications development for heterogeous networks. Source code and documentation.
  • BERT 77 - Parallelizing compiler for Fortran 77. Software download, reference manual, mailing list. Free.
  • Unified Parallel C at George Washington University - Community site: projects, news, FAQ, documents, publications, tutorials, forum, mail list, work groups, events, downloads.
  • Mesham - By using type based parallelism the programmer can write very efficient, simple, code targeted at Grids, Clusters or SMPs in this language. Full online documentation and source/binaries available for download.
  • NESL - A functional parallel language. Tutorial, source code, algorithm library, animations, and reference manual.

  • Unified Parallel C: UPC - Extensions to C to support distinctions between local and shared data structures, and pointers to them; for high performance computing on large-scale parallel machines, uniform programming model for shared and distributed memory.
  • Mentat - Object-oriented parallel language based on C++. Documentation, source code and binaries, and sample programs.
  • Charm++ - An object-oriented portable parallel language built on top of C++. Source code, binaries, manuals, and publications.
  • The SR Programming Language - Synchronizing Resources is a language for writing concurrent programs. Source code, mailing list archive, and documentation.
  • The Cilk Project - A language for multithreaded parallel programming based on ANSI C. Source code, manual, papers, and research into parallel chess programs.
  • PARLANSE - A parallel programming language supporting symbolic computation on SMP workstations.
  • ZPL - An array programming language. Sample code, papers, recipes, reference manual, and source code.
